Web17 apr. 2024 · The database engine runs a separate process that scans the current conflict graph for lock-wait cycles (which are caused by deadlocks). When a cycle is detected, the database engine picks one transaction and aborts it, causing its locks to be released, so that the other transaction can make progress. Kharge and many others at 24, Akbar … Web27 mei 2024 · Now, let’s see how we can monitor this deadlock using system_health extended event in SSMS. To do so, we connect to our instance on SSMS, go to Management > Extended Events -> system_health and right click on package0.event_file under system_health. We can then see the below information.
